What is a Deepfake?
"Deepfake" technology uses artificial intelligence to create convincing images, audio, and video hoaxes. It can superimpose a person’s face onto another’s body with startling accuracy. While sometimes used for satire or entertainment, the technology is increasingly weaponized against women in the public eye to create non-consensual explicit imagery.

Legal and Ethical Implications
Governments and tech platforms are playing catch-up with this technology. In many jurisdictions, creating and distributing non-consensual deepfake pornography is becoming a criminal offense. However, the sheer volume of content uploaded every minute makes moderation a challenge.

Katrina Kaif starred in the 2009 underwater action thriller Blue, which featured a high-profile cast including Akshay Kumar, Sanjay Dutt, and Lara Dutta.
Role & Visuals: While she had a smaller role, her appearance was part of the film's "glamorous" underwater aesthetic.
Performance: Despite being one of India's most expensive films at the time with a budget of ₹80 crore, it was a box-office failure, grossing only ₹38 crore. 2. Deepfake Controversies
Katrina Kaif has been a high-profile victim of deepfake technology, where AI is used to superimpose her face onto explicit or misleading video content.
Legal Action: These viral "blue films" (a slang term for adult content in South Asia) are synthetic and illegal. The Indian government has cited Section 66D of the Information Technology Act, which carries a penalty of up to 3 years imprisonment for personation through computer resources.
Public Outrage: Following deepfakes of Kaif and fellow actress Rashmika Mandanna, there were widespread calls for social media platforms to remove such content within 24 hours of reporting. 3. Iconic Fashion Moments
